Destiny: Old Exotic Gear Getting Year Two Upgrades
One of the drawbacks in moving forward with Destiny for the latest expansion, The Taken King, is that a lot of the old gear players grinded away to get quickly became obsolete. Various weapons you worked so hard to get were not as high level as they were before. The Ice Breaker could no longer raise your Light Level to a more competitive range. However, that is soon all about to change. On the official Destiny Instagram account, Bungie has revealed various weapons and gear that are getting Year Two upgrades that will go into affect for the game’s upcoming December update.
Here is the full list (via Gamespot) of upgraded weapons and armor that now have more competitive levels for The Taken King expansion.
Weapons:
- Mida Multi-Tool (scout rifle)
- Plan C (fusion rifle)
- Dragon’s Breath (rocket launcher)
- Super Good Advice (machine gun)
- No Land Beyond (sniper rifle)
- Hard Light (auto rifle)
Armor:
- Nothing Manacles (Warlock gauntlets)
- The Armamentarium (Titan chest)
- ATS/8 Tarantella (Hunter chest)
- Peregrine Greaves (Titan legs)
- Apotheosis Veil (Warlock helmet)
- Radiant Dance Machines (Hunter legs)
- Achlyophage Symbiote (Hunter helmet)
- Twilight Garrison (Titan chest)
- Bones of Eao (Hunter legs)
The Year Two versions of the weapons will be available starting with the game’s December update next month. They can be earned just like other Exotic items ,and they will be up for sale through kiosks at the Tower.
